Capacity

The cubic foot capacity of the refrigerator determines how much room you can put in the fridge and freezer. A couple who live together can do with a refrigerator that is in the 20-24 cubic feet range, whereas families with four or more may need a larger fridge with 25+ cubic feet. If you frequently host parties an extra-large fridge that includes a pantry drawer to provide additional food storage is a good choice.

If you're looking to purchase a new refrigerator, be sure to measure the openings of your cabinets. Also, look at the doors of your kitchen. This will ensure that your refrigerator will fit. Jessica Petrino Ball, the director of the educational program at appliance retailer AJ Madison is also adamant about checking out the width and depth of the fridge can be placed to be able to accommodate all of your storage needs.

Energy efficiency is a different factor when you are looking for the ideal French door refrigerator. The refrigerator you choose should be well-ventilated and located away from sources of heat such as ovens and dishwashers. This will allow for adequate airflow, and also prevent the refrigerator from working harder to cool.

The French-door design offers several advantages over the traditional side-by-side style, including better accessibility and efficiency in energy use. Doors are opened from the center instead of from the edges which reduces the loss of cold air and makes them more effective. In addition, many French-door models come with separate freezer compartments that are located below the refrigerated section similar to the layout of a bottom-freezer model. This lets you store items that are used frequently at the front of your refrigerator to make it easier to access. They also generally consume less energy than top-freezer models. Find a French-door refrigerator equipped with an ENERGY STAR label to maximize your energy savings.
